#c4b49e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c4b49e is composed of 76.9% red, 70.6%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.2% magenta, 19.4%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 34.7 degrees, a saturation of 24.4% and a lightness of 69.4%. #c4b49e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#89693d.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#c4b49e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c4b49e has RGB values of R:196, G:180,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.19,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12891294.

Shades and Tints of #c4b49e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#f8f6f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c4b49e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b2b1b0 is the less saturated color, while #fabd68 is the most saturated one.
